Steps to ABG analysis 
*Step 1* 
: Analyze the pH 
<7.35 Acidosis 
>7.45 alkalosis 
label it. 
ABG analysis 
*Step 2* 
: Analyze the CO2 
<35 is alkalotic 
>45 is acidic 
2 
label it. 
ABG analysis 
*Step 3* 
: Analyze the HCO3 
<22 acidotic 
>26 alkalotic 
label it 
ABG analysis 
*Step 4* 
: Match the CO2 or the HCO3 
with the pH 
if the pH and CO2 are acidotic then the acid-base disturbance is caused by the respiratory 
system

Diagnose the patient: 
pH = 7.1 (ACIDIC) 
pCO2 = 40 mm Hg (normal) 
HCO3 = 18 (Acidic) - *Metabolic acidosis 
-Pt could have ketoacidosis 
-The body will compensate by blowing off and lowering CO2 to become more basic 
Diagnose the patient: 
pH = 7.1 (ACIDIC) 
PCO2 = 60 MM HG (ACIDIC) 
HCO3 = 22 (normal) - *Respiratory acidosis 
-Body will increase HCO3 to compensate so pH will come back to normal range (done by kidneys) 
Diagnose the patient: 
pH = 7.35 (normal/A) 
PCO2 = 65 mm (ACIDIC)

A patient who has required prolonged mechanical ventilation has the following arterial blood gas results: 
pH 7.48, PaO2 85 mm Hg, PaCO2 32 mm Hg, and HCO3 25 mEq/L. The nurse interprets these results as 
a. metabolic acidosis. 
b. metabolic alkalosis. 
c. respiratory acidosis. 
d. respiratory alkalosis. - ANS: D 
The pH indicates that the patient has alkalosis and the low PaCO2 indicates a respiratory cause. The 
other responses are incorrect based on the pH and the normal HCO3.
